{"id":2186,"edition":12,"categories":1,"features":0,"size":12949,"name":"plusminus13","authors":[{"name":"Jure Triglav","url":"https://juretriglav.si","twitter":"juretriglav","login":"jure","gh":238667}],"description":"
13 is bad, but can be good too. Just like this game. Probably needs a non-potato computer and mobile is not supported.
\nWASD or arrow keys for movement, spacebar for shield.
\nMusic theme by Zarja. Play testing: Aleks and Zarja. Thank you!
\nThis is a tech demo of sorts, of a global illumination approach developed by Alexander Sannikov, called radiance cascades. This particular game’s engine is a raw WebGL port of Jason McGhee’s Three.js based blog post. I’ll be releasing this mini engine as standalone soon.
\n","source":"jure/plusminus13","stars":2,"yt":"4-g27hhuMcw","comments":[{"at":378882075,"author":"Mark Vasilkov","login":"mvasilkov","gh":140257,"url":"https://mvasilkov.animuchan.net","twitter":"mvasilkov","text":"This one looks fantastic! These radiance cascades is my favorite thing now.
\nThe music speeding up is a great touch and contributes beautifully to the tension.
\nThis is my favorite “need to take it apart and learn how it’s done” game this year. I think you’ve mentioned releasing the renderer as a standalone library, please ping me when you do! :)
\n","games":["Shoot 13 Nomsters","King Thirteen"]},{"at":379042665,"author":"xem","login":"xem","gh":1225909,"text":"I see someone had fun with lighting :p
\n","games":["O HIII BAD SKATEPARK","EMOJIPHOBIA","GREAT PLUMBER 65"]},{"at":379062187,"author":"Christoph Schansky","login":"DerBenniBanni","gh":5499976,"text":"Amazing lighting tech! The optical presentation and the music add a lot to the quite simple gameplay.\nAnd the highscores at the end motivate to give it another try. And another,… :-)
\n","games":["Aargh! Triskaideka attacks!"]},{"typ":2,"at":379077604,"author":"Christer Kaitila","login":"McFunkypants","gh":2111957,"url":"http://www.mcfunkypants.com","text":"the lighting is so cool! the soft shadows and glows and shines on the floor really knocked my socks off. this would be amazing at any size, and is doubly so for how small the code is for such a cool entry. it ran nice and smoothly on my old pc! awesome work. I’d love to see this engine used for a cyberpunk style game that is mostly dark except for long lines of glowy neon!! I bet it would look so cool using your tech. =) keep up the great work.
\n"},{"at":379102787,"author":"WHITE6982","login":"WHITE6982","gh":181463855,"text":"The neon lighting is looks Good and the music is also Great.
\n","games":["13 Cards Dungeon"]},{"at":379248182,"author":"Ryan Tyler","login":"tyler6699","gh":50468,"url":"https://carelesslabs.co.uk","text":"Looks great, the best graphics of all the game so far! Nice mucic also. There must be so many games this type of look and feel could be used for!
\nDeserves a greater than 13k version!
\n","games":["The Fear Factory"]},{"typ":2,"at":379265631,"author":"Michelle Duke","login":"mishmanners","gh":36594527,"url":"mishmanners.info","twitter":"MishManners","text":"Fun music and sound effects. Loving the graphics.
\nI liked that the levels started easier and got harder and faster; I feel like the music got faster with the faster animations which was really cool. Nice work on this game, it was super fun. Lovely lighting effects, good smooth animations, intuitive controls, and overall great job.
\nGame over screen is good, maybe add a 60% background so can easily read the text over the rest of the game. If you wanted to make it even better (although you’re right on the 13kB limit), add an intro screen and it’d add that extra cherry on top.
\nGood GitHub README, add a few extra pieces of info and I’d be perfect.
\n"},{"at":379503463,"author":"Jasper Renow-Clarke","login":"picosonic","gh":26137750,"twitter":"femtosonic","text":"The lighting was impressive.
\nUnfortunately, the framerate on my PC was too low on this game to be able to manoeuvre the character towards the other game pieces.
\nStill it did look great
\n","games":["rollermaze"]},{"typ":1,"at":379560226,"re":379503463,"author":"Jure Triglav","login":"jure","gh":238667,"url":"https://juretriglav.si","twitter":"juretriglav","text":"Sorry about that - it’s quite resource intensive, unfortunately. I hope you can return some time in the future with a beefier GPU and, after you’re done winning in a fully path-traced Doom or something, play a round of plusminus13 :). Thanks for playing!
\n"},{"at":379597276,"author":"Cody Ebberson","login":"codyebberson","gh":749094,"url":"https://cody.ebberson.com","twitter":"codyebberson","text":"Nice looking game. My final score was 384 (669). It was really fun to watch your progress on Slack and see this come together. Also educational, as I had to read about radiance cascades after seeing the screenshots 😀 Great job, congrats!
\n","games":["Phantomicus"]},{"at":380063717,"author":"Jonathan Vallet","login":"jonathan-vallet","gh":5329099,"text":"impressive lightning effects!\nGameplay is simple but funny. Having a music is cool too!
\n","games":["13 Steps to Escape"]},{"at":380236750,"author":"Almar Suarez","login":"wololoa","gh":10622012,"twitter":"repunkgame","text":"Radiance cascades FTW ! :)
\nSmall feedback: I have a somewhat beefy computer and it still run below 30 fps - I suggest downsampling it a bit (it will still look awesome setting probes each 2 or 4 pixels apart). I know it might not be trivial but having minimal settings would help a lot too.
\nAnd I do not have color blindness but it was hard to deciphering the glyphs anyways - using a different color palette might be helpful.
\nHaving said that, I like a lot the way you managed to fit the theme in the game and the game’s engine looks very cool. Well done! :)
\n","games":["DECK 13"]},{"typ":2,"at":380329269,"author":"Clément Pasteau","login":"ClementPasteau","gh":4895034,"twitter":"ClementPasteau","text":"Nice one!
\nUnfortunately, my laptop couldn’t run it smooth enough to enjoy it haha\nI have an integrated GPU card, yet it’s a good laptop.\nBut I think you can definitely optimize the performance of the game, maybe removing some effects?\nOtherwise you’re not gonna have a lot of players :)
\n"},{"at":380425594,"author":"João Lopes","login":"lopis","gh":2715751,"url":"www.jlopes.dev","text":"It looks really cool, but i’m not able to play either on my integrated GPU, and thus can’t vote. I literally get 1FPS on FIrefox :’) Maybe you could add a “low graphics” button for us common folk?
\n","games":["Thirteen Terrible Stunts"]},{"typ":1,"at":380426501,"re":380425594,"author":"Jure Triglav","login":"jure","gh":238667,"url":"https://juretriglav.si","twitter":"juretriglav","text":"Yeah, apologies about the performance requirements! Radiance cascades are more performant than alternatives, or, in other words, they provide much higher quality at a given performance cost, but they are still an active area of research and there’s not that much that can be done here without severely degrading the quality of the image.
\nIn a perfect world, had I not been pressed for time, I would have implemented proper scaling, so that low perf setups could at least play at a low resolution in a small window. Currently the size of all elements is absolute, making smaller window sizes unplayable.
\nHowever, since JS13K is, like diamonds, forever :), I hope you’ll be able to revisit this game at a later point and play it in all its beauty.
\n"},{"at":380556958,"author":"Isaac Benitez","login":"isacben","gh":37629156,"url":"https://www.linkedin.com/in/isacben/","text":"Very cool visual effect. I remember from last year, you games a very technical, which is interesting. Would like to have a look to the postmortem, if you write one.
\nCongrats!
\n","games":["Unblock"]}],"results":{"theme":{"rank":90,"min":1,"score":2.44,"max":4.2},"innovation":{"rank":79,"min":1,"score":2.8,"max":4.47},"gameplay":{"rank":130,"min":1,"score":2.24,"max":4.29},"graphics":{"rank":28,"min":1,"score":3.84,"max":4.76},"audio":{"rank":31,"min":1,"score":3.4,"max":4.34},"controls":{"rank":87,"min":1,"score":2.8,"max":4.24},"primary":{"rank":66,"min":6,"score":17.52,"max":24.47},"label":"Overall"}}